Taiga is the open-source agile project-management platform operated by Kaleidos (Madrid, Spain; founded 2014), released under Mozilla Public License 2.0 with the full server-side stack available on GitHub for self-host on any EU infrastructure: Scrum, Kanban, issue tracking, customisable dashboards; the hosted tier (tree.taiga.io) provides the managed alternative for teams who don't want to operate the stack themselves. Self-hosting on EU infrastructure gives the customer full data control with no CLOUD Act exposure; the managed-cloud tier is EU-owned with a public DPA and ES-only named sub-processors (verified 2026-05-18), hosted at the Interxion MAD3 datacentre in Madrid, where Digital Realty/Interxion acts only as the physical colocation landlord with no logical access to customer data and no US-owned hyperscaler sits in the customer-data path, so under a customer-data-at-rest definition CLOUD Act exposure is none.

Taiga is the open-source agile project-management platform operated by Kaleidos, a Madrid-based Spanish software cooperative that built and continues to maintain the project since 2014. The platform is positioned as the open-source Jira / Linear / Clickup alternative: Scrum sprints, Kanban boards, issue tracking, customisable dashboards, video-call integrations, and a wiki module, all under the Mozilla Public License 2.0 with the full server-side code on GitHub. Taiga is widely used in EU public administrations, universities, and open-source-friendly engineering teams.
Two deployment paths are offered. Self-hosted on the customer's own infrastructure (Hetzner / OVHcloud / Scaleway / private DC) makes the customer the sole data controller and operator, with no CLOUD Act exposure. The managed cloud at tree.taiga.io is the alternative for teams who prefer not to run the stack themselves; the managed tier runs from the Interxion MAD3 datacentre in Madrid, where Digital Realty/Interxion is only the physical colocation landlord with no logical access to customer data and no US-owned hyperscaler sits in the customer-data path, so under a customer-data-at-rest definition its CLOUD Act exposure is none. The combination of MPL-2.0 licensing and a Spanish-owned operating cooperative makes Taiga the strongest agile / Scrum entry on this directory.
